Abstract

An adapter for converting signals in a first format to signals in a second format for enabling a personal electronic device such as laptop computer, tablet computer, smartphone and the like, to communicate with a contactless smart card reader via another adapter. Embodiments include an adapter for enabling a personal electronic device to communicate, via communication channel comprising data signals over universal serial bus (USB) channel, with a contactless smart card reader.

Claims (21)

1. A system for enabling a personal electronic device to communicate over near field communication (NFC), the system comprising:

a first adapter configured to convert signals between a universal serial bus (USB) signal format and signals in a format of data modulated over audio signals, the first adapter comprising:

a USB connector configured to communicate with the personal electronic device using signals in the USB signal format;

a headset audio connector configured to communicate with a second adapter using the modulated audio signal format; and

a controller configured to convert signals between the USB signal format received from the USB connector and signals in the modulated audio signal format to be communicated over the headset audio connector of the first adapter to the second adapter;

a second adapter configured to exchange data with the headset audio connector of the first adapter using the signals in the modulated audio signal format and to switch between communicating signals in a contact mode of communication and a contactless mode of communication over near field communication (NFC).

2. The system of claim 1 wherein said controller in the first adapter comprises a non-transitory storage medium storing programs and parameters.

3. The system of claim 1 wherein the contact communication of said second adapter is disabled in response to radio frequency (RF) field sensed by said antenna.

4. The system of claim 1 , wherein a RF signal received by said antenna is prevented from reaching said combination contact/contactless chip in response to an ANT DIS signal.

5. The system of claim 1 , where said second adapter further comprises a power supply unit.

6. The system of claim 5 further comprising a charger unit to charge a battery comprised in said power supply unit.

7. The system of claim 5 , wherein said power supply further comprises DC-DC step-down converter for receiving electrical power from said power supply unit and convert its voltage to approximately 1.8V DC.

8. The system of claim 7 , wherein said DC-DC step-down converter is enabled only if at least one signal from a list comprising 5V USB signal and MIC signal from said headset audio connector is present.

9. The system of claim 1 , wherein the first adapter comprises a voltage regulator to regulate DC voltage received from the USB connector and to regulate and provide DC voltage to the headset audio connector.

10. A method for enabling a personal electronic device to communicate over near field communication (NFC), the method comprising:

in a first adapter configured to convert signals between a universal serial bus (USB) signal format and signals in a format of data modulated over audio signals:

communicating with the personal electronic device via a USB connector supporting signals in the USB signal format;

converting signals between the USB signal format received from the USB connector and signals in the modulated audio signal format; and

communicating the signals in the modulated audio signal format with a second adapter via the headset audio connector,

in the second adapter configured to exchange data with the headset audio connector of the first adapter using the signals in the modulated audio signal format:

switching between communicating signals in a contact mode of communication and a contactless mode of communication over near field communication (NFC).
